Tomorrow is the day the King’s 10th Anniversary Celebration begins, bringing a large batch of rewards to claim. Thinking about it is quite thrilling! Many players are focusing on the limited-time vouchers, but actually, other benefits are pretty good too. For example, the Rose Hearts giveaway reaches 50, allowing many players who have saved 100 or more Rose Hearts to directly redeem a Treasure Pavilion skin. Currently, there are seven skins in the Treasure Pavilion— which ones are recommended for redemption?

Top recommendations are Yixing’s “Way of All Things” and Ying Zheng’s “Elegant Lover.” Yixing’s skin was added this year during the Spring Festival. It blends sci-fi fantasy with the ancient style of Chang’an city. Yixing’s look is quite interesting: his clothing is a traditional robe, but his cape is made of a futuristic energy material. In-game, the effects primarily feature blue gradients, with skill sounds combining electric currents and glass breaking, giving a strong hit feedback that makes gameplay smooth. The ultimate skill recreates the Chang’an city scene on a chessboard, making the overall visual quite impressive. Yixing has had many skins in recent years, such as the KPL exclusive “Blazing Yixing” and the “Dreamkeeper” collaboration, but those are limited editions. This is currently the only free skin available, so it’s highly recommended.

Ying Zheng’s skin is one of the earliest in the Treasure Pavilion, originally exclusive to beta testers, then given out in limited quantities during anniversaries, and now regularly available. This skin has been optimized several times, so its effects keep up with the times. For example, the normal attacks now feature a left-hand light raise release, a design breakthrough that looks better than other skins. The effects mainly use deep blue rose colors with petals and rose patterns, creating delicate visuals that might give opponents the impression of low damage. Ying Zheng is one of the few heroes exclusive to vouchers, with relatively few skins. Except for last year’s legendary “Xuanlei Tianjun,” the priority of “Elegant Lover” can be raised.
Ji Xiaoman’s “Delusional Taste” and Sun Shangxiang’s “Elegant Lover.” Ji Xiaoman’s skin is quite good, part of the Delusional City series, with bright orange effects. The concept is creative, based on a food streamer theme, incorporating many related elements in the effects. Personally, I like it, but its priority is lower because Ji Xiaoman has had many new skins recently, including the “Battle Dancer” from the international server, the QQ Speed collaboration “Little Orange,” and this year’s free collaboration skin “Little Duck.” Also, Ji Xiaoman’s strength is not as high as before, so it’s recommended later in the order.

Sun Shangxiang’s skin basically follows the same path as Ying Zheng’s, even sharing the same name. The effects are decent, but the roses are pink to better fit Sun Shangxiang’s female hero identity. The feel of this skin is average, with no particularly good hit feedback, so it’s recommended lower in priority. Moreover, Sun Shangxiang seems to have no shortage of skins, with more than ten covering almost all quality tiers. The only missing one is the “Peerless” skin, and even free skins like “Fruit Sweetheart” are available, so this can be considered later.
This tier consists of hero skins: Gao Jianli’s “Playful Dragon,” Eileen’s “Valkyrie,” and Gan Jiang & Mo Ye’s “Nutcracker.” Honestly, redeeming these skins isn’t very meaningful. Gao Jianli doesn’t have many skins; although there was a 60-voucher hero skin released this year, the effects are average. “Playful Dragon” hasn’t changed much visually but is creative, so it’s prioritized here. Eileen’s skin was originally exclusive to beta testers but was later added to the Treasure Pavilion after her rework. It was worth redeeming, but tomorrow a free hero skin named “Crane’s Heart” will be available, which, although also hero quality, has better effects than “Valkyrie,” so it’s recommended only for collection. As for Gan Jiang & Mo Ye, this skin’s inclusion in the Treasure Pavilion is puzzling. Its effects and creativity are quite average, so it’s not recommended.

Of course, if none of the above skins appeal to you, you can hold off on redeeming and keep your Rose Hearts. This item lasts long and accumulates over time; it won’t be cleared when the Treasure Pavilion closes. The Pavilion opens four times a year, so you can redeem when you need to, with a maximum of 299 hearts stored. The key point is that “Way of All Things” was added during this year’s Spring Festival and has been available for some time. The next skin addition’s timing is unknown, so if you don’t have a desired skin now, it’s better to wait for the new one before deciding.
